Output 8cec247a410723e9594bc1b53f61f3cc35e445320b15047450ec882a106eb1ff:2

value
135595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4857548efe7a36ad172253f693e27101083d73b OP_EQUAL
address
3Kc8EycftxHA96bR7DRdStvQNNedrWKUf8
transaction
8cec247a410723e9594bc1b53f61f3cc35e445320b15047450ec882a106eb1ff
spent
true